Snoring And Chronic Bronchitis Linked

A new study has revealed that a person who does quite a bit of snoring has an increased risk to develop chronic bronchitisHollywood (dbTechno) – A new study has revealed that a person who does quite a bit of snoring has an increased risk to develop chronic bronchitis.

Chronic bronchitis is a cough which can last for weeks and keep coming back in a recurring form throughout several years.

Inkyung Baik of Korea University Ansan Hospital led the study in South Korea and found that people who snore regularly have a 25% to 68% increased change of developing chronic bronchitis.

This was compared directly to people who did not snore at all.

The author stated “Our findings may provide novel information that snores are at greater risk of developing chronic bronchitis than persons who do not snore during sleep.”

They looked at over 4,000 individuals in Korea to come up with their results.

Those who snored five times a week or less had a 25% increased risk of chronic bronchitis. Those who snored six to seven times per week had a 68% increased risk.
